.faqs{display:flex;flex-direction:column;row-gap:1.6rem;padding-top:4.8rem;padding-bottom:6rem;max-width:110rem;margin-left:auto;margin-right:auto}.faqs__title{margin:0;font-weight:400;font-size:2rem;line-height:1.1;letter-spacing:0%;color:rgb(var(--color-brand-4))}.faqs__list{display:flex;flex-direction:column;row-gap:1.6rem}.faqs__item{border-radius:.4rem;border:.1rem solid rgb(var(--color-gray-200));background-color:rgb(var(--color-gray-100))}.faqs__question{display:flex;justify-content:space-between;align-items:center;gap:1rem;width:100%;margin:0;padding:1.5rem;border:none;border-radius:.4rem;background:none;font:inherit;text-align:left;cursor:pointer;transition:padding-bottom .17s ease-out}.faqs__question>span:first-child{flex:1;min-width:0;font-size:1.4rem;line-height:1.43;letter-spacing:0%;color:rgb(var(--color-brand-4))}.faqs__icon{flex-shrink:0;position:relative;width:1.4rem;height:1.4rem;color:rgb(var(--color-gray-500))}.faqs__icon-plus,.faqs__icon-minus{position:absolute;top:0;right:0;bottom:0;left:0;display:block;opacity:1;transform:rotate(0) scale(1);transition:opacity .17s ease,transform .17s ease}.faqs__icon-plus svg,.faqs__icon-minus svg{display:block;width:100%;height:100%}.faqs__icon-minus{opacity:0;pointer-events:none;transform:rotate(-90deg) scale(.9)}.faqs__item--open .faqs__icon-plus{opacity:0;pointer-events:none;transform:rotate(90deg) scale(.9)}.faqs__item--open .faqs__icon-minus{opacity:1;pointer-events:auto;transform:rotate(0) scale(1)}.faqs__answer{display:grid;grid-template-rows:0fr;transition:grid-template-rows .28s ease-out}.faqs__item--open .faqs__answer{grid-template-rows:1fr}.faqs__answer-inner{overflow:hidden;min-height:0;padding:0 1.6rem;transition:padding .28s ease-out}.faqs__item--open .faqs__answer,.faqs__item--open .faqs__answer-inner{transition-delay:.02s}.faqs__item:not(.faqs__item--open) .faqs__answer,.faqs__item:not(.faqs__item--open) .faqs__answer-inner{transition-delay:0s}.faqs__item--open .faqs__question{padding-bottom:1rem}.faqs__item--open .faqs__answer-inner{padding:0 1.6rem 1.6rem}.faqs__answer-inner *{margin:0;font-size:1.3rem;line-height:1.6;color:rgb(var(--color-slate-700))}@media(prefers-reduced-motion:reduce){.faqs__answer,.faqs__answer-inner,.faqs__icon-plus,.faqs__icon-minus{transition:none;transition-delay:0s}}@media screen and (min-width:750px){.faqs{row-gap:3.2rem;padding-bottom:8rem}.faqs__title{font-size:2.4rem;line-height:1.25}}
/*# sourceMappingURL=/cdn/shop/t/44/assets/section-faqs.css.map */
